Unlike gas or wood-burning units, electric fireplaces don't require venting. Wall-mount or freestanding models that plug-in are easy enough for homeowners to set up on a weekend. Electric fireplaces that are built-in or recessed will require an electrician to connect the electrical system.

Energy-Efficient
In contrast to wood-burning fireplaces which require regular deliveries of firewood and chimney maintenance, electric models provide instant warmth and ambiance at the touch of one button. They also improve the quality of indoor air without causing a rise in heating costs.
When selecting an electric fireplace, you need to check the BTU heat output and wattage ratings so that you can be sure that you're getting enough heat for your room size. You could also choose a model with adjustable wattage settings to lower energy consumption. If you can, think about a wall-mounted unit that's designed to be recessed into the wall for a bespoke integrated appearance. This reduces the amount of protrusion from the wall and helps to save space in your home.
You should also look for remote controls and timers, that will allow you manage the settings more effectively and reduce unnecessary use. You can also improve efficiency by keeping your fireplace clean and positioning furniture strategically to allow for optimal heat circulation. You should consider installing insulation in your home as well as draft-exclusion devices to prevent warm air from leaving.

Low Maintenance
Contrary to wood-burning or gas-burning fireplaces which require large chimney systems venting, costly remodeling, and expensive repairs, an electric wall-mounted fireplace is simple to set up. Electric fireplaces don't run by gas, so there is no need for gas lines or flues. Plug them into any three-spot socket that is standard. They don't produce smoke, ash or odors and do not require regular cleaning like traditional fireplaces.
They can be hung directly over the mantle, or built into a bump-out on the wall of your home. white wall hung electric fire include mounting hardware, so you can hang them over your TV, art, or in your bedroom, office or living room. The raised installation also helps to save floor space and allows for heat circulation.
Some models are fully recessed, allowing them to slide into a framed and finished wall opening. Others are semi-recessed, which means they extend only a few inches. white wall mounted electric fireplaces come with a range of finishes and choices, including glass fronts and log sets, so you can choose the best one for your space.
When it comes down to maintenance, a few simple daily maintenance tips can keep your fireplace in top condition for years to come. Make use of a vacuum brush or a cloth to remove dust or debris from the exterior of your fireplace. Make sure that there are there aren't any decorative objects or furniture are blocking the heater vents. Obstructions can block airflow and cause an overheating.
Check the instructions of the manufacturer to determine any maintenance requirements. For example, some models may suggest replacing the light strips every two years. Unplug the fireplace and then wait 15 minutes until it cools down. Then follow the directions from the manufacturer regarding the replacement.

Focal Point
A white fireplace creates the perfect focal point for a room. It's easy to pair a white fireplace with traditional or contemporary elements for a balanced look. Create symmetry and utility by the addition of wall sconces, built-ins or a wood mantel.
A white wall-mounted electric fireplace can be stunning centerpieces in any space, even if you are unable to install a wood-burning or gas-burning fireplace. These fireplaces are equipped with flames and ember beds with LEDs with more than six color options which allows you to customize the appearance to suit your mood. Some models also come with an adjustable heat function, so you can use the fireplace year-round.
A majority of electric fireplaces come with an attached bracket that allows them to be hung in the style of a picture. Find the studs on your wall, mark the spot you'd like to position the fireplace, and use a level to ensure the brackets are evenly spaced.
